Quilt Raffle Winner!
Cathy McCall, from the NMC Business Office, is the winner of the quilt raffle at this year's NMC BBQ. The raffle raised $866 that will go toward offering another $1,250 scholarship this year to a deserving student. Many thanks for the many hands that made this...

Cindy Duby, Employee of the Semester
Cindy Duby, Office Manager – Social Sciences Academic Area, has been selected as the NMC Employee of the Semester for spring 2012. Cindy is pictured receiving the award from Social Science instructor Sean Ruane and NMC President Timothy J. Nelson. Cindy's colleagues...
